The Assistant Manager of Guest Programs is responsible for assisting the Manager of Guest Programs in overseeing interpretive team members and programs ensuring that a safe, interactive, and engaging experience is available for all aquarium guests. The main responsibilities of this position include scheduling and supervision of Guest Programs Team Specialist Staff and Volunteers, coordination, and implementation of public and educational programs, ensuring guest and animal safety procedures are followed, and assisting with evaluations of interpretive team members. The focus of this position is to oversee Guest Programs staffing for public and educational programming including floor engagement, backstage tours, celebrations, proposals, sleepovers, after hour special events, and special day events (e.g., World Oceans Day); assist in the planning and implementation of departmental programming; and supervision of gallery and floor operations. The Assistant Manager serves as the facility’s acting manager on duty in the absence of the Manager and Sr. Manager of Guest Programs and will be required to act in this role to ensure guest satisfaction and service recovery goals are met.
